摘要

As parallel and distributed computing environments, like the PC cluster or the GRID, become more popular, high performance parallel and distributed programs become increasingly more necessary. Within the family of such programs, those that are based on message-passing are frequently characterized by unpredictable delays in message arrival times, which lead to significant differences in program performance. This paper reports the development of a simulator that measures program performance under parallel and distributed computing environments with variable parameters. Also, two types of numerical experiments are presented: one that was conducted on a program of matrix multiplication whose performance does not depend as much on communication delays and another experiment conducted on a program of branch and bound technique whose performance is more dependent on communication delays. Both experiments were performed in the simulator presented here, as well as in a real PC cluster environment. Through these numerical experiments, the effectiveness and problems of the simulator are discussed.
